The AP Top 25
The Top 25 teams in The Associated Press college football poll, with first-place votes in parentheses, records through Sept. 1, total points based on 25 points for a first-place vote through one point for a 25th-place vote, and previous ranking:
Record Pts Pvs
1. Southern Cal (21) 1-0 1,539 3
2. Georgia (20) 1-0 1,506 1
3. Ohio St. (15) 1-0 1,497 2
4. Oklahoma (2) 1-0 1,432 4
5. Florida (5) 1-0 1,415 5
6. Missouri (1) 1-0 1,301 6
7. LSU (1) 1-0 1,207 7
8. West Virginia 1-0 1,108 8
9. Auburn 1-0 1,033 10
10. Texas 1-0 1,028 11
11. Wisconsin 1-0 849 13
12. Texas Tech 1-0 842 12
13. Alabama 1-0 834 24
14. Kansas 1-0 748 14
15. Arizona St. 1-0 672 15
15. BYU 1-0 672 16
17. South Florida 1-0 588 19
18. Oregon 1-0 508 21
19. Penn St. 1-0 467 22
20. Wake Forest 1-0 414 23
21. Fresno St. 1-0 242 —
22. Utah 1-0 214 —
23. UCLA 1-0 151 —
24. Illinois 0-1 147 20
24. South Carolina 1-0 147 —
Others receiving votes: Clemson 143, East Carolina 108, California 91, Boston College 36, Florida St. 36, Cincinnati 35, Tennessee 30, Boise St. 19, Bowling Green 17, Virginia Tech 14, Connecticut 9, Rutgers 6, Kentucky 5, Nebraska 4, Oklahoma St. 3, Arizona 2, TCU 2, Miami 1, North Carolina 1, Notre Dame 1, Tulsa 1.
USA Today Top 25 Poll
The Top 25 teams in the USA Today college football coaches poll, with first-place votes in parentheses, records through Sept. 1, total points based on 25 points for a first-place vote through one point for a 25th-place vote, and previous ranking:
Record Pts Pvs
1. Southern California (23) 1-0 1,462 2
2. Georgia (20) 1-0 1,442 1
3. Ohio State (10) 1-0 1,385 3
4. Oklahoma (2) 1-0 1,344 4
5. Florida (3) 1-0 1,295 5
6. LSU (3) 1-0 1,202 6
7. Missouri 1-0 1,197 7
8. West Virginia 1-0 1,035 8
9. Texas 1-0 1,030 10
10. Auburn 1-0 962 11
11. Wisconsin 1-0 853 12
12. Kansas 1-0 820 13
13. Texas Tech 1-0 732 14
14. Arizona State 1-0 679 16
15. Brigham Young 1-0 629 17
16. Oregon 1-0 566 20
17. Alabama 1-0 538 NR
18. South Florida 1-0 480 21
19. Penn State 1-0 450 22
20. Wake Forest 1-0 388 23
21. Fresno State 1-0 269 25
22. Clemson 0-1 186 9
23. Utah 1-0 158 NR
24. South Carolina 1-0 134 NR
25. Illinois 0-1 92 19
Others receiving votes: UCLA 91; California 79; East Carolina 56; Tennessee 56; Boston College 36; Florida State 29; Virginia Tech 25; Boise State 24; Kentucky 20; TCU 15; Cincinnati 13; Connecticut 13; Nebraska 12; Arizona 8; Oklahoma State 5; Notre Dame 4; Colorado 3; Bowling Green 2; Georgia Tech 2; Central Florida 1; Miami (Fla.) 1; Stanford 1; Tulsa 1.
